Navigate on the left-menu: Startup > Tasks. Next we will install the Meslo Nerd Font pack (recommended for PowerLevel10k zsh theme). WSL has brought a Linux kernel to Windows 10. As stated before, I'm mainly going to use the terminal inside VSCode, so I'm . Once you're ready to swap to a theme, follow the steps . Connect and share knowledge within a single location that is structured and easy to search. Seems like I'm not alone, lots of people seem very interested in the new Windows Terminal and also how to use it with WSL. Type fc-list | grep -i "meslo" to know the names of other fonts so you can use other fonts in the terminal. Step 1 - Install Windows Terminal. Powerine font test. Start by installing a nerd font from here. wsltty terminal emulator. Installing Fonts. A very cool font that I have been using, that have powerline glyphs support, is the Cascadia Code from Microsoft, which is available . Also in my tmux bar, on the right of zsh it is supposed the be all grey up to the other side but you can only see the beginning. gsbhasin123 13 April 2020 03:09 #4. 3. If you use gui version of Vim (MacVim, GVim) you need to set the font in .vimrc, for example: set guifont=DejaVu\ Sans:s12. You can achieve this by copying the guid value of your Linux distribution into defaultProfile in settings.json. Done. While the initial setup can be a little bit heavy, once done we could see that the Microk8s was acting as intended and the complete load on RAM (OS + three WSL instances + Microk8s three nodes) is around 9Go (~75% of the 12Go total): In the long run, WSL2 will get even better and more performant. Anything will suffice. Step 2: Install the new fonts. For the dividers between segments, the powerline uses some unicode glyphs that must be present in the font used by the terminal.. WARNING: do not forget to select fonts that are compatible with these unicode glyphs on the settings.json. How to make a pretty prompt in Windows Terminal with Powerline, Nerd Fonts, Cascadia Code, WSL, and oh-my-posh Step Two for PowerShell - Posh-Git and Oh-My-Posh Per these directions, install Posh-Git and Oh-My-Posh. Go to settings. March 4, 2022 in quel est le meilleur poste au quidditch talbott . Now, open Hyper Terminal, go to Edit > Preferences. Extract Font File. To customize the colors, font and keyboard bindings, you can click on Settings.It will open a text file with a JSON object inside. . How to make a pretty prompt in Windows Terminal with Powerline, Nerd Fonts, Cascadia Code, WSL, and oh-my-posh. This is done by going to this GitHub repo and downloading the MesloLGS NF Regular.ttf font and clicking on the Install button. In this post I will explain my WSL setup quickly. The first thing we want to do is get rid of the God awful ConHost terminal that WSL uses by default. I've found using Windows Subsystem For Linux (WSL) in the last two years has transformed how I use my Windows machine for development and general tech & cloud work. The downloaded fonts are usually in a zipped file. First, go to the Nerd-Font homepage and select a Font you like. Basically, Powerline fonts will get installed at ~/.local/share/fonts inside WSL. For the dividers between segments, the powerline uses some unicode glyphs that must be present in the font used by the terminal.. For Ubuntu App: Open the Ubuntu app. Close and reopen your terminal and it should be working. We'll take the new Cascadia Code, run Ubuntu on Windows . Today I was installing Oh My ZSH and the theme Agnoster and it worked in the the normal terminal but not in Visual Studio Code's terminal, as it needs a monospaced font and Powerline isn't one.. This is pretty simple to do; first clone the repository, install the fonts and delete the repository. Powerine font test. Customize the new Windows Terminal with a Cascadia Code, Powerline, Nerd Fonts, Oh My Posh and more! schmaler und breiter weg kindergottesdienst. First things first - you need a terminal. A very cool font that I have been using, that have powerline glyphs support, is the Cascadia Code from Microsoft, which is . March 4, 2022 in quel est le meilleur poste au quidditch talbott . Also I mention how you can launch X-Windows applications. Here's some of my posts. Open Properties Navigate to the Font tab In the Font section, select a Powerline font (e.g. Install Nerd-Fonts in Windows. First, go to the Nerd-Font homepage and select a Font you like. Run this command sudo fc-cache -vf /usr/share/fonts/ In settings.json of vscode add this line "terminal.integrated.fontFamily": "MesloLGM Nerd Font", Save and Restart if necessary, it should work. Download and expand the Powerline fonts repository: powershell-command "& . Feel free to also adjust the font size to your preference. However, I was looking through these forums for issues where the tiny little boxes would not appear. Change the font, font size there too, like this an example : // default font size in pixels for all tabs fontSize: 18, // font family with optional fallbacks fontFamily: 'Inconsolata for Powerline', font there too : Conclusion. Next, configure your bash shell to use powerline by default. wsl powerline fonts not working infermiere polizia di stato stipendi wsl powerline fonts not working. You should see the file settings.json. I work in Windows from time to time. This also assumes you've installed Git for Windows. Windows itself comes with the command prompt and the PowerShell. Before we do that however, we'll head back to Windows and grab some fonts to help us render Powerline properly. WARNING: do not forget to select fonts that are compatible with these unicode glyphs on the settings.json. The new Terminal has further cemented this new reliance on the command line. This is pretty simple to do; first clone the repository, install the fonts and delete the repository. Microsoft has provided a pretty cool integration for VS Code to access files on WSL. X server may need to be restarted for the changes to take effect. Open the Properties dialog. Now press that windows icon from your keyboard and search for Font Settings . You can opt to just install the specific font (s) you want, please adjust accordintly in that case. Open ConEmu, and go to Settings. Note: Installing powerline-fonts does not provide any of the patched fonts from powerline-fonts-git AUR. . For the dividers between segments, the powerline uses some unicode glyphs that must be present in the font used by the terminal.. WARNING: do not forget to select fonts that are compatible with these unicode glyphs on your terminal configuration. I do have admin rights on my machine My shell and tmux setup. First step is to make sure we have oh-my-zsh instead inside WSL. wsl. [ Log in to get rid of this advertisement] Hello guys, For the first time I have installed fish and oh-my-fish. If you are using PowerShell, you can display every available theme using the following PowerShell cmdlet. Select some font like DejaVu Sans Mono for Powerline with Font size around 16. Very late. The prompt is styled using Oh-My-Posh and is using the Caskaydia Cove Nerd Font, which can be downloaded from Nerd Fonts. I will explain why I use it, its benefits and limitations. terminal emulator) must also either be configured to use patched fonts (in some cases even support it because custom glyphs live in private use area which some applications reserve for themselves) or support fontconfig for powerline to work properly with powerline-specific glyphs. # For Powershell echo "Powerline glyphs: Code points Glyphe Description `u{E0A0} Version control branch `u{E0A1} LN (line) symbol `u{E0A2} Closed padlock `u{E0B0} Rightwards . GitHub Gist: instantly share code, notes, and snippets. Turns out it was because my version of Windows 10 Pro was not activated. Getting docker to work with WSL involves a few extra steps which I'll detail below: Install Docker for Windows. For both the "Main console font" and "Alternative Font", select a font that has "Powerline" in the name. Install VS Code on Windows. Powerline Shell uses custom patched fonts for the glyph icons it uses. If you use Vim in terminal you should switch to the appropriate font in profile preferences of your terminal. That symbol is from "Nerd fonts", not "Powerline fonts" (nerd fonts include powerline fonts). Save the settings. Let's step through how to set that up! (Also sorin is the best omz prompt) . v2 runs better due to it using a real linux kernel rather than a wrapper, but currently can only be installed on the windows insider program. I have tried to install the .ttf files both manually and via the included install.ps1 file install wsl v1. That's partly because this is a fancy prompt that needs a Powerline-patched font to render correctly. Installing the fonts will take some time and very in your face about it. Contrary to the documentation, you actually need to install these fonts in Windows and set the console host font to one of them. Writing the article on the Tilix Powerline setup made me realize that I wanted a similar spiffy prompt in Windows. Configure VS Code to work with WSL. VS Code defaults the terminal's font to the editor's font, and since the Agnoster theme needs Powerline, the terminal . While I was trying to setup powerline fonts, I notice that some symbols from fish was messed up, like this: While in root I can see at least one character (green arrow poiting) and I have one missing . To use WSL, enable the aptly named "Windows Subsystem for Linux" feature. If custom symbols still can't be seen then double-check that the font have been installed to a valid X font path. NOTE: Choose Expose daemon on TCP without TLS for WSL 1. The used application (e.g. In this article. I'd suggest getting a nerd font instead. # Add the Universe repo sudo add-apt-repository universe # Install Powerline sudo apt install -y powerline Configure Powerline in Bash Install Powerline Fonts. Select some font like DejaVu Sans Mono for Powerline with Font size around 16. Note that not all of them work well with all zsh themes, you may need to try out different ones. /* Download a powerline font like Cascadia Code PL and then add it to your VsCode settings.json using */ { "terminal.integrated.fontFamily": "Cascadia Code PL", } Follow GREPPER The default setup for WSL is anything but perfect but it's possible to get a really nice looking, highly functional setup with just a little bit of work. Navigate to a folder where you . If custom symbols cannot be seen then try closing all instances of the terminal emulator. e.g. GitHub Gist: instantly share code, notes, and snippets. AZShell I'd suggest getting a nerd font instead. hornbach gasflasche tv abgelaufen; . Set Powerline Fonts. Install Go and Powerline-Go. First, go to the Nerd-Font homepage and select a Font you like. 1 Make sure that you are pointing VIM to the powerline bindings folder (it took me a while to understand that by just running the installer, this folder was still not avalailable). Now you need to install the font to your system. Contrary to the documentation, you actually need to install these fonts in Windows and set the console host font to one of them. Open up powershell as administrator. Install Go, then Powerline-Go, below commands should do the work. I found this out by trying to search for Fonts in the settings, and was unable to search for any of the Nerd Fonts I thought I had downloaded. WSL stands for the Windows Subsystem for Linux. Set Powerline Fonts. Font settings. This will enable powerline-go on your bash shell. Windows Terminal will start PowerShell by default, now let's switch it to WSL2. One thing you can do to see if all the other parts of the installation went well, is to select the powerline font itself inside vim (or gvim). My colors setup. If you're using a different shell, check out the documentation for tips. I used bash::ubuntu to group Ubuntu into the bash tasks. The Windows Terminal is a nice addition to Windows, but doesn't ship with Windows 10. Based on the instructions found here we should do the following: cd ~ mkdir .fonts unzip ~/Downloads/Meslo.zip -d ~/.fonts/Meslo fc-cache -fv. I recommend using Meslo. Step 0 (We are programmers) - Windows Terminal. There, click at the + button at the bottom. Open Windows Terminal and open the settings with Ctrl + , shortcut. . Select the profile where you wish to apply the font, PowerShell for example, and then the Appearance tab. Extract the zip file in Linux by right-clicking and selecting extract. Below are some screenshots of the more common themes. We'll take the new Cascadia Code, run Ubuntu on Windows . This is done by going to this GitHub repo and downloading the MesloLGS NF Regular.ttf font and clicking on the Install button. That symbol is from "Nerd fonts", not "Powerline fonts" (nerd fonts include powerline fonts). To make Windows Terminal able to render the icons we're using in "zsh" later, we need to install the Nerd-Fonts on our Windows. Read on if you're on WSL 1 or upgrade your distribution to WSL 2. Usage Bash. In my case, I tried several times to follow Scott's tutorial step by step, but . The app is free, and you can install it directly from Windows Store: It serves as your central entry point embracing all the . It has many limitations, this not working completely is just one of them. Grab the .complete.ttf version, and install it right-clicking on it in Explorer and selecting 'install'. In the bar of the bottom of vim, text like NORMAL and 0/1 are supposed to have a white background like they have in the first screenshot. Click OK. Next we will install the Meslo Nerd Font pack (recommended for PowerLevel10k zsh theme). Any set of font referred to as 'nerd fonts' will work, and we'll use the excellent Delugia Nerd Font. Select OK Install Powerline In our terminal, we'll want to install Powerline. First step is to make sure we have oh-my-zsh instead inside WSL. Final step remaining is installing a Powerline font that allows special characters. Choose your theme! Let's take a look at how I have everything set up. If they do not, then there is something else that needs fixing. (Also sorin is the best omz prompt) . 2. But there is a better way to start your journey: The Windows Terminal app. Add a name for the task. Setting Bash on Ubuntu task in ConEmu#. Installing Powerline Fonts . Install-Module posh-git -Scope CurrentUser Install-Module oh-my-posh -Scope CurrentUser Run these commands from PowerShell or PowerShell Core. 1. . To set a Nerd Font for use with Oh My Posh and Terminal Icons, open the Windows Terminal settings UI by selecting Settings (Ctrl+,) from your Windows Terminal dropdown menu. . Install Nerd-Fonts in Windows. Fish shell not showing flag icons. Before we proceed, let's download and install a font that supports icons and ligatures - MesloLGS NF, download the 4 TTF files and right-click Install inside Windows Explorer.If you already have such a font you'd like to use, you can skip this part. Open CMDER, click the icon in the top left and go to settings, and then fonts. Customize the new Windows Terminal with a Cascadia Code, Powerline, Nerd Fonts, Oh My Posh and more! My fonts setup. In this post I'll explain how to quickly fix it. You can now choose the theme you want for your terminal, there are many to choose from. It will cover only following topics: Configuration of WSL. Add the below shell script to your ~/.bashrc file. open powershell as admin and run: 0 1 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Windows-Subsystem-Linux 0. reboot computer. I've long blogged about my love of setting up a nice terminal, getting the prompt just right, setting my colors, fonts, glyphs, and more. Double-click on the font file. The screen-256color or xterm-256color values work fine in our environments. . (debian) PS: After installation it is required to reset the font cache so that it can then be reflected in your system. gsbhasin123 13 April 2020 03:09 #4. ProFont for Powerline ). Installing Powerline on WSL Windows 10 Install the Powerline status plugin on the Windows Subsystem for Linux (WSL). Themes. wsl powerline fonts not working. The rest of these instructions assume you're using Fedora's standard bash shell. I got the same set up to work on Windows terminal in WSL so it shouldn't be a problem here. wsl powerline fonts not working. The correct font usually ends with for Powerline. Launch Docker for Windows and go to the Settings tab. Then we log out of the shell and re open the shell. Installing Fonts. Although the text will look unworkable, at the very least now the powerline should show the correct fonts. Change the font, font size there too, like this an example : // default font size in pixels for all tabs fontSize: 18, // font family with optional fallbacks fontFamily: 'Inconsolata for Powerline', font there too : Powerline Shell uses custom patched fonts for the glyph icons it uses. Oh My Posh comes with many themes included out-of-the-box. To install the utility, open a terminal and run this command: sudo dnf install powerline powerline-fonts. Now, open Hyper Terminal, go to Edit > Preferences. From the Font tab, select one of the Powerline fonts, such as ProFont for Powerline. You can find more information here :help guifont. For example, Vim inside of tmux doesn't show colored Powerline segments. These fonts can be copied to someplace on your windows directory. Here I am writing about WSL1, because this is the version I use today. Update .bashrc file. Skip to content. Then we log out of the shell and re open the shell. It might not be a powerline issue, but it is something I only encounter on WSL . If not, check the Powerline bash prompt usage instructions to ensure that it has not changed. cp ~/.local/share/fonts/* /mnt/d/fonts/ This will copy all the ttf files to a folder names fonts on my d drive. 10 comments flxw commented on Feb 26, 2017 edited Download from https://github.com/powerline/fonts Extract, and click "Install" on the context-menu. The problem Problem. I got the same set up to work on Windows terminal in WSL so it shouldn't be a problem here. Windows Termianl. For the full updated list of themes, view the themes in Github. If you're on WSL 2 that's it. Now go to this extracted folder and look for .ttf (TrueType Fonts) or .otf (openType Fonts) files. . In my case I moved the powerline folder to /opt, so in my .vimrc I have a line that: set rtp+=/opt/powerline-develop/powerline/bindings/vim Using WSL, I have managed to get the fonts to display earlier, but after having done a complete re-installation of WSL, Ubuntu, ZSH and Ohmyzsh, I cannot get the Awesome-Powerline Fonts to display correctly. It is a terminal in the Linux-sense, and support tabs and . On Task parameters choose an icon for the task. With the nerd font installed on the system we need to get Gnome Terminal to use it now. Q&A for work. To make Windows Terminal able to render the icons we're using in "zsh" later, we need to install the Nerd-Fonts on our Windows. install powerline fonts with your package manager. WSL2 is the new version of WSL, available to only Windows insiders for now . Back to the WSL . Note that not all of them work well with all zsh themes, you may need to try out different ones. To do this, open up a PowerShell window as adminstrator. Update the json, list one of the Powerline fonts. I recommend PowerShell 6.2.3 or above.